This review is from: Spider-Man Official Strategy Guide (Paperback)
Spider Man the game was great. I bought this guide expecting maps and detailed level walk throughs. This book delivered what I was looking for and included a gallery of random comic covers found in the game. The small flaw was that it didn't include the various cheats and codes needed for the game. But if you want them, you could find them on various sites. If you buy, Spider Man, the game, I suggest buying this stragery guide for the information it contains...because sometimes a wall crawler needs help.

Sorry to contradict the last couple of guys, but the book does contain cheat codes. Inside there is a poster. At the bottom of the poster, under the headings, 'Bradygames Acknowledgements', 'Special Spider-man Team', and 'Special Thanks To'there are cheat codes.

This review is from: Spider-Man Official Strategy Guide (Paperback)
I just don't understand why you would spend an additional... [money] for this strategy guide. Don't get me wrong, Spider-Man is a great game and was well worth my money, but 95 percent of gamers won't feel a need for this unnessesary add-on.

As the previous reviewer mentioned, you get a good walkthrough but no cheats. Why do you need a walkthrough, though? The game is exquisitely rendered, but it is not a large game. If you are a fast learner or a great gamer, I suspect you could beat this game in a weekend without the help of a guide.

So why don't you need a guide? First off, there is a pretty nice training mode in the game where you can hone your Spidey skills. Secondly, no part of the game is particularly difficult or immense. Finally, you are given a pseudo-tutorial during the few spots you could get stumped. For example, I had a hard time finding Venom in the sewers, but after awhile, you run into Lizard and he tells you which tunnels you should take.

Like I said before, the game is great and I would recommend it to almost anyone. But it isn't a game that requires a guide. You're smart enough to do it yourself!
